引言

近年来,量子计算已然成为科技界的热门话题。其超越经典计算机的能力让人们对未来的计算、通信、加密和其他领域充满期待。与此同时,加密货币作为一种新兴的数字资产,其背后使用的区块链技术及其安全性也备受关注。本文将深入探讨量子计算对加密货币的影响,以及它在未来的发展前景。

量子计算的基本概念

量子计算是基于量子力学原理进行计算的一种新兴技术。与经典计算机采用的二进制计算不同,量子计算机使用量子比特(qubits),可以同时处理多种状态。这使得量子计算在某些特定任务上的计算能力远超传统计算机。例如,在处理大数据、最问题和复杂的分子计算方面,量子计算展现出了巨大的潜力。

加密货币的基础知识

加密货币是基于区块链技术的一种数字货币,它使用加密技术来保证交易的安全性和隐私性。比特币是最早也是最著名的加密货币,自2009年推出以来,其价格和使用范围都经历了巨大的波动和增长。加密货币的去中心化特性使其脱离了传统金融体系的束缚,但这也使得其面临许多安全隐患和监管挑战。

量子计算对加密算法的威胁

加密货币的安全性主要依赖于公钥加密和散列函数,如SHA-256和RIPEMD-160。这些算法在经典计算机中是难以破解的,但量子计算的出现可能改变这一切。著名的量子算法,肖尔算法(Shor's algorithm),能够在多项式时间内因式分解大数,从而有效破解依赖于 RSA 和 ECC 等公钥加密算法的加密机制。

这意味着,量子计算机一旦成熟,可能对现有加密货币的安全架构造成深远影响。黑客将能够利用量子计算的能力,快速破解数字钱包的私钥,轻而易举地获取用户的数字资产。在这种情况下,传统的加密货币面临着前所未有的风险。

现行加密货币的应对措施

为了应对量子计算带来的威胁,加密货币的开发者们正在研究许多不同的解决方案。当前主要的应对措施包括:

  • 量子抗性加密算法: 这类算法旨在设计出可以抵抗量子计算攻击的加密机制。例如,格基密码(lattice-based cryptography),哈希基密码(hash-based cryptography)及多变量多项式密码等,都被认为是具备量子抗性的可能候选方案。
  • 混合加密方案: 结合现有的公钥密码体系与量子抗性算法,形成一个复合的加密方案,这样即使量子计算技术成熟,依然可以通过多重保护机制来守护用户资产。
  • 升级现有系统: 对于流行的加密货币,开发者们可以通过硬分叉(hard fork)等方式来升级区块链系统,引入新的加密协议,从而提高抵抗量子攻击的能力。

量子计算与区块链技术的结合

尽管量子计算对现有加密货币构成威胁,但它也可以与区块链技术结合,使其具备更高的安全性和效率。例如,量子随机数生成器可以生成更为安全的密钥,使得交易的不可预测性更强,有助于提高交易过程的安全性。

另外,量子通信技术,例如量子密钥分发(QKD),能够在不可能被窃听的情况下进行安全通信,这对金融交易的安全性和隐私保护具有重要意义。通过将量子通信技术与区块链结合,未来的金融交易可能变得更加透明、安全且高效。

量子计算与智能合约

智能合约是自动执行的合约,能够在区块链上实现预设条件下的执行。量子计算的引入有可能提升智能合约的能力。例如,利用量子计算的高效性,可以实现更复杂的合约设计和执行,不再受到经典计算能力的限制。这可能推动去中心化金融(DeFi)等领域的发展。

然而,智能合约同样需要考虑量子计算带来的安全隐患。量子攻击可能会破坏智能合约的安全性,因此开发量子抗性的合约设计将成为必要的研究方向。这意味着区块链技术的未来将需要量子计算的知识,以实现更佳的合约安全性以及执行效率。

未来展望: 量子计算与加密货币的融合之路

展望未来,量子计算与加密货币的结合朝着几个方向发展。首先是技术更新升级。当量子计算技术进入实际应用阶段,加密货币的技术架构必定经历一次升级,以保持其安全性和竞争力。

其次,金融科技公司与学术机构的合作将增强这一领域的研究动力。通过联合研发,量子抗性算法及量子通信技术的广泛应用可能加速推动整个加密货币产业的转型。

最后,监管政策的逐步完善也将促进量子计算与加密货币的良性发展。全球范围内对于加密货币的监管政策仍在不断演变,特别是在量子计算迅速发展的背景下,如何设立合适的监管框架,以促进技术进步并保证用户安全,是一项复杂而紧迫的任务。

可能相关的问题

1. 量子计算如何影响密码学的未来?

量子计算的出现将对传统密码学造成巨大冲击。现有的许多加密算法(如RSA、DHE等)可能不再安全,因为量子计算利用肖尔算法可以在多项式时间内破解这些算法。因此,密码学家们必须开发出具有量子抗性的算法,以保护数据与通信的安全。此外,量子计算有望推动新的安全协议的形成,开辟新的安全通信方式。

2. 加密货币如何采取措施预防量子攻击?

加密货币协会与开发者正在积极研究如何预防量子攻击,主要措施包括采用量子安全的加密算法、引入混合加密机制、以硬分叉方式进行系统升级等。此外,在新的合约设计中应加入量子抗性算法的支持,以确保智能合约在量子技术迅速发展的未来依然安全可靠。

3. 哪些加密货币已经开始考虑量子抗性?

一些领先的加密货币项目已开始关注量子安全性。例如,比特币现金和以太坊等项目正在积极探讨量子抗性加密方案。此外,部分专注于安全性的新兴加密货币已经将量子抗性算法作为其基础架构的一部分,努力在未来挑战中保持竞争力。

4. 量子计算对传统金融机构有什么影响?

量子计算可能改变传统金融机构运营的方式。一方面,量子计算能够提升数据分析速度,使金融机构在风控、信用评估等方面的决策更加精准;另一方面,量子攻击也对银行和保险公司的数据安全构成威胁。因此,金融机构需要逐步提升自身的技术水平,以应对量子计算带来的新危险与机遇。

5. 区块链能否和量子计算共存?

区块链和量子计算并非对立的存在,它们可以相辅相成。量子计算有潜力提升区块链交易的安全性与效率,同时,量子计算的进展将引导区块链技术的创新。未来,只有充分理解两者的内在关系和相互影响,才能建设一个更加安全、灵活的金融生态系统。因此,将量子计算融入区块链的研究仍是一个重要的课题。

<空白>